Responsibilities

  • Must be able to take and carry out direct orders from Cellar Lead, Cellar Supervisors, Assistant Cellar Supervisor and/or Winemakers.
  • Must have good communication skills, both verbal and written.
  • Verify all information on process orders prior to starting any job.
  • Complete all tasks and jobs according to current SOP.
  • Update process orders when transfers begin and are completed.
  • Update all required paperwork including log sheets.
  • It will be mandatory to learn at least 1/3rd of the Operator Standard Operating Procedures, plus everchanging as the company grows.
  • Must successfully pass an exam on each procedure when training is deemed sufficient by a supervisor.
  • Operating filter equipment, working on a platform, using D.E. (diatomaceous earth), requires medical clearance and fit testing for wearing an approved respirator.
  • Be able to do limited dump truck and forklift operations to make miscellaneous transfers.
  • Perform any reasonable request by any supervisor.
  • Must have above average attendance. To be considered for advancement to the next level must have an attendance record at or below First Written Warning.
  • Must have demonstrated good performance, attitude and behavior.
  • Must be able to work any shift, weekends and overtime as needed.
  • Assist in training Operator Trainees as assigned.
